WHAT:

The EZChrom Elite™ driver system is a unified computing strategy engineered by PerkinElmer® that seamlessly integrates with their high performance liquid and gas chromatography instruments. Designed to provide a uniform user interface for analytical laboratories, this new capability can perform instrument control and data collection, data analysis and centralized reporting from a variety of instruments, now including the Flexar™ LC and Clarus® GC systems.

WHY: Agilent’s® EZChrom Elite™ is one of the most widely deployed chromatography data systems (CDS) in the industry. Now that PerkinElmer has developed compatibility with this system, users have more flexibility, choice and access to high quality, reliable hardware with one consistent operating system.

WHAT IT DOES:This chromatography data system (CDS) performs two noteworthy operations:

Specific ‘drivers’ work with the software to allow for instrument control.

  • Example: A lab user can operate the detector in a GC or LC instrument using the EZChrom program instead of directly controlling the instrument.
  • EZChrom Elite™ monitors feedback from components in PerkinElmer Flexar or Clarus hardware, such as data from the detector or feedback on how much pressure is in the pump.


    THE BENEFITS:Ease of one system – The EZChrom drivers seamlessly integrate with PerkinElmer Flexar and Clarus chromatography systems, giving users more flexibility and choice of hardware with a unified software platform.

    A consistent and reliable workflow - Operators can avoid unnecessary training on new CDS if they transfer between labs. EZChrom drivers can eliminate this type of interruption to workflow.

    Better data management - For Clarus GC users in regulated and non-regulated labs, the EZChrom driver helps streamline workflows and simplifies the management of large volumes of data.

    The Clarus® 680 GC is designed for fast-paced, high-volume laboratories that require fast analytical cycle times. It maximizes throughput with the fastest injection-to-injection time of any conventional gas chromatograph. The Clarus 680 GC incorporates many other PerkinElmer innovations that provide unprecedented operational simplicity and outstanding flexibility while removing the barriers to productivity that can arise with more demanding samples and applications. The fastest temperature programmable inlets available combined with programmable pneumatic control (PPC) provides simple and straightforward solutions to complex analyses such as analysis for methanol in crude oil or determination of pesticides in food. Its near-ambient performances make the Clarus 680 GC the instrument of choice for the separation of light volatile components or when Large Volume Injection is required to run high-sensitivity GC/MS applications. Complete instrument control is available through TotalChrom and TurboMass as well as Waters® Empower™ 2 and Agilent® EZChrom Elite™ drivers. Features/Benefits Patented high-performance oven - the unique oven design of the Clarus 680 GC provides the fastest available heat-up and cool-down rate, enabling shorter injection-to-injection and analytical cycle times, maximizing your sample throughput and achieve maximum return on your investment •  Its twin-walled oven design with concentric air exhaust* allows the user to achieve greater separation at near-ambient temperatures without the use of special coolants, especially important for the analysis of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s). •  Fast oven heat-up allows faster chromatography, particularly useful when speeding up the elution of late eluting compounds. •  Fastest available cool-down rate is delivered using forced convection air. This greatly reduces non-productive time between runs. •  Universal Programmable Split-Splitless (PSS) and Programmable On-Column (POC) injectors design enables Large Volume Injection of volatile solvents and cold on-column injections without the use of expensive cooling agents •  Novel Swafer™ micro-flow technology dramatically simplifies complex tasks helping to make the Clarus 680 GC easily used by operators at all skill levels •  Complete instrument control is available through TotalChrom™, TurboMass™ as well as Waters® Empower™ 2 and Agilent® EZChrom Elite™ drivers.
